By Dillon Friday

When the final buzzer sounded Tuesday night, the Haverford half of a sold-out crowd spilled onto the floor for a celebration 44 years in the making. For the first time since Steve Joachim and Ray Edeleman got them to the 1970 state final before falling, the Fords were headed to the PIAA Tournament.

“Just look around,” said Haverford coach Keith Heinerichs, gesturing to the mob of red and yellow that engulfed his team. “We worked hard every day for this.”

How long had the drought been? Well, when senior captain Tom Leibig climbed the ladder to ceremoniously cut down the net, Heinerichs had to instruct him on how it’s done.

“The top strings,” the coach said, miming a cutting motion with his fingers.
